1. A slide-track buffering device with a smoothly sliding carriage, comprising:

  • a control stand on which there are a baseplate, a guide plate extending forward from said baseplate, a guide chute at said guide plate'"'"'s rear part, and a beveled resisting groove at said guide chute'"'"'s front part;

    a slide carriage which slides on and covers said guide plate and comprises a shorter first area in the back as well as a longer second area in the front wherein said first area is provided with a locator underneath and an accommodating groove in front of said locator and said second area is provided with a protective guide plate opposite to said guide chute;

    at least a spring linking between said control stand and said slide carriage;

    at least a buffering member fixed on said slide carriage and provided with a buffer pole protruding backward for engaging said buffer pole'"'"'s rear tip with said control stand;

    a swing member which is held in said accommodating groove and located between said slide carriage and said control stand and provided with (a) a joint hole in the back and a boss underneath wherein said joint hole allows said locator to be held inside and said boss slides and is held in said guide chute and (b) a first guide shoe and a central thrust pad which are located at one flank and separated in order to correspond to the accommodating groove wherein said swing member is further provided with a second guide shoe in front of said central thrust pad for development of a groove between said central thrust pad and said first guide shoe.
